INGREDIENTS
Dry Ingredients
- 1 ½ cups whole wheat flour
- ½ cup white sugar
- ½ teaspoon baking soda
- 🧂 ½ teaspoon salt
Wet Ingredients
- ½ cup vegetable oil
- 1 (4 ounce) container applesauce
- 1 tablespoon vanilla-flavored almond milk
- 1 tablespoon vanilla extract
Coating
- ½ cup cinnamon-sugar
STEPS
Preheat oven to 375 degrees F (190 degrees C).
Mix flour, sugar, baking soda, and salt together in a bowl.
Beat vegetable oil, applesauce, almond milk, and vanilla extract together in a separate large bowl. Add flour mixture and stir until combined.
Divide dough into 14 portions and roll into balls. Spread cinnamon-sugar into a wide, shallow bowl. Roll dough balls in the cinnamon-sugar and arrange onto a baking sheet.
Bake in preheated oven until golden brown, about 10 minutes.

💡 For a slight crunch, replace half of the applesauce with coconut sugar.Use parchment paper on your baking sheet to make cleanup easier.Store cookies in an airtight container to keep them fresh for up to a week.Make a bigger batch and freeze the dough for quick baking later.
